• Cu-ZSM-5 nanosheets have been synthesized by ion-exchanging method.
• Nanosheets show higher activity in N2O decomposition than conventional zeolites.
• Nanosheets also exhibit much better stability in N2O decomposition.
• Better reducibility of Cu+ and easier desorption of oxygen were observed.
ZSM-5 nanosheets were prepared using [C18H37-N+(CH3)2-C6H12-N+(CH3)2-C6H13]Br2 as a template and then ion-exchanged with Cu cations. The catalytic performance of the obtained Cu-ZSM-5 nanosheets in N2O decomposition was investigated and compared with that of conventional Cu-ZSM-5. Higher activity as well as better stability was observed for Cu-ZSM-5 nanosheets although the Cu contents of the catalysts were identical. Relevant characterization was conducted using XRF, ICP, XRD, N2 adsorption–desorption, SEM, TEM, CO-IR, H2-TPR and O2-TPD. The data show that the better catalytic performance of Cu-ZSM-5 nanosheets is probably due to better accessibility of active sites, better reducibility of active Cu+ species, and the weakened interaction between oxygen and Cu+ sites.
